Botframework 微软机器人程序框架(Node.js-SDK4)和#x2B;微软图形API
Microsoft Bot Framework Node.js-SDK4是否可能自动从Microsoft帐户(如登录Sharepoint的用户)识别登录的用户,以便我可以直接在Bot上使用Microsoft Graph services,而无需询问用户登录名和密码 我这样问是因为我有一个运行在sharepoint页面上的bot,理论上,当用户开始与bot对话时,他已经登录了microsoft帐户。检查此代码Botframework 微软机器人程序框架(Node.js-SDK4)和#x2B;微软图形API,botframework,microsoft-graph-api,Botframework,Microsoft Graph Api,Microsoft Bot Framework Node.js-SDK4是否可能自动从Microsoft帐户(如登录Sharepoint的用户)识别登录的用户,以便我可以直接在Bot上使用Microsoft Graph services,而无需询问用户登录名和密码 我这样问是因为我有一个运行在sharepoint页面上的bot,理论上,当用户开始与bot对话时,他已经登录了microsoft帐户。检查此代码 { ResponseIds.Greeting, (con
{ ResponseIds.Greeting, (context, data) => {
var greetings = JsonConvert.DeserializeObject<Greetings>
(MainStrings.GREETING);
Random r = new Random( );
int index = r.Next( greetings.messages.Count );
return greetings.messages[index].message.Replace("
{username}",context.Activity.From.Name);
}
{ResponseIds.Greeting,(上下文,数据)=>{
var greetings=JsonConvert.DeserializeObject
(打招呼);
Random r=新的Random();
int index=r.Next(greetings.messages.Count);
回信问候语。邮件[index]。邮件。替换(“
{username}”,context.Activity.From.Name);
}
否则,我会看到一个身份验证对话框,它可能会执行类似的操作您找到解决方案了吗?Sharepoint显然只支持iFrame嵌入,但请检查这一点和解决方法—这一点也一样